NX编程五大核心步骤详解_数控编程是_这一步骤是后续所有工作的基础确保产品设计的准确性和可行性
NX编程五大核心步骤详解
NX编程,全称Siemens NX编程,是一种用于计算机辅助设计和制造的综合性软件。它包含以下五个主要步骤:
一、设计建模
设计建模是NX编程的起点,设计师利用NX软件构建三维模型。这一步骤是后续所有工作的基础,确保产品设计的准确性和可行性。
二、数控编程
数控编程是NX的核心功能之一。它通过创建数控代码,将设计模型转换为机床能识别的指令,从而控制机床进行零部件加工。这个过程包括选择合适的刀具、设定切割参数和优化工具路径。
三、仿真分析
仿真分析是提前预防生产问题,提升产品性能的关键步骤。NX编程软件可以进行应力分析、热分析和动态模拟,确保设计在投入生产前就能发现问题。
四、工具路径生成
工具路径生成是实现高效、精确加工的关键。在NX中,这一步是自动化的,软件会根据设计模型和工艺预设定生成最优刀具运动路径。
五、文档和报告制作
制造过程中,详细的文档和报告对保证质量和追踪进程至关重要。NX编程可以自动生成工具列表、加工参数、检查报告等文档,确保加工过程的准确性和可追溯性。
NX编程FAQs
以下是对NX编程的一些常见疑问的解答:
1. 什么是NX编程?
NX编程是指使用Siemens NX软件进行计算机辅助设计和制造的编程过程。NX是一款功能强大的集成CAD/CAM/CAE解决方案,涵盖了设计、建模、仿真和加工等多个工艺。
2. 学习NX编程可以获得哪些技能和知识?
学习NX编程,您可以掌握以下技能和知识:
- CAD设计:包括创建2D和3D几何体、获取测量数据、编辑和变换模型等。
- CAM编程:学习生成加工路径、选择刀具和加工参数、进行仿真和优化等。
- CAE模拟:包括模型网格划分、施加边界条件、进行结构和流体分析等技术。
- 自定义工具和脚本:了解如何使用NX Open API和其他编程语言开发自定义工具和脚本。
3. 学习NX编程的用途和职业前景如何?
学习NX编程为您打开了众多职业发展机会,包括:
- CAD/CAM工程师
- 产品开发专家
- 制造工程师
- 自动化专家
学习NX编程将使您在制造和工程领域发挥重要作用,并为您的职业发展带来丰富的机会和挑战。